Solution:
Given No. of sample = 64
Sample Mean = 51.80
Population mean = 50
Population Standard deviation =15
Here sample size is greater than 30 and data is normal so we will use Z test and standard devaition is also known
Z = (51.8-50)/15/sqrt(64) = 1.8/15/8 = 0.96
Here Null Hypothsis is School Maths mean score <= 50
Alternate Hypothesis is School Maths mean score > 50
So it is right tailed test so P- value = (1- 0.8315) = 0.1685
Alpha = 0.05
so here we can see that p-value is greater than alpha value so we have weak evidence against the null hypothesis so we are failed to reject the null hypothesis.
and its answer is C. i.e. there is not enough evidence to conclude that the second graders in her district have greater math skill.
